#13736d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#13736d is composed of 7.5% red, 45.1% green and 42.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 83.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 5.2% yellow and 54.9% black. It has a hue angle of 176.3 degrees, a saturation of 71.6% and a lightness of 26.3%. #13736d color hex could be obtained by blending #26e6da with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006666.

#13736d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#13736d has RGB values of R:19, G:115, B:109 and CMYK values of C:0.83, M:0, Y:0.05, K:0.55. Its decimal value is 1274733.

Shades and Tints of #13736d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020e0d is the darkest color, while #fcfffe is the lightest one.
